Best Time To Visit Kamala Beach
Best Time To Visit
The best time to visit Kamala Beach is during the dry season, from November to April. During these months, the weather is warm and sunny, with minimal rainfall, making it ideal for beach activities and outdoor exploration. The sea is calm, perfect for swimming, snorkeling, and other water sports. This period also coincides with the peak tourist season, so expect more visitors and higher accommodation rates. However, the vibrant atmosphere and numerous events make it a lively time to experience the local culture and festivities.
